ADTRAN is seeking a highly motivated Network Management Specialist to join their team in Munich, Germany. The role involves providing expert knowledge of Network Management Systems and SDN to pre-sales teams, handling tender responses, customer presentations, and training. The specialist will also provide market trend feedback to Business Development and Product Line Management. This position requires a strong background in network management and excellent communication skills.

About The Company

Adtran is a leading global provider of fiber-based networking solutions and SaaS applications, focused on the broadband access market. Our comprehensive portfolio spans from the metro core to the customer premises, enabling network providers to deliver Gigabit broadband to every home and business.
